	I'm not sure whether this has been mentioned before (nothing showed up on my search), but the kit has some serious and not so serious issues.
</p>

<p>
	The serious one is that the inner structure of the loading box sidewalls is very prominently repeating itself as sink marks on the outside surfaces.<br />
	This doesn't show very well on my photos (sorry, can't do any better), but it means you either have to to do a lot of putty work, and I do mean a lot, or cover them with thin styrene sheet.<br />

	<span style="background-color:#ffffff;color:#353c41;font-size:14px;">You can see a photo of the test shot (courtesy of James Duff, and repeated below this note in this thread, again courtesy of James) in the same thread topic on the New Car Kits section of the Industry News section of the forum, but today at the NNL East Round 2 unveiled their latest "clone" project, a redo of the original AMT 1963 F100 pickup kit, in this case, the 1968 kit release with the added camper top shell.  </span>
</p>

<p>
	<span style="background-color:#ffffff;color:#353c41;font-size:14px;">This new "kit clone" tooling was apparently designed from the start as a parallel part of the 1960 F100 tooling set.  The body itself appears a much higher quality casting (at least based on what I see here) than the original 1963/1964/1968 AMT kit release, eliminating many of the sags, sink marks, and so forth of the original.  It also has a far better execution of the 1963-only upper bodyside molding.  The engine is apparently the same Y-Block as in the 1960 kit.  This and the 1960 are apparently on pretty much the same glide path in terms of development timing; reportedly they should appear on the market either at approximately the same time or the second one soon after the first one debut.  </span>

	Heller announced a German standardised 3 ton trailer of the kind that was in use from the 1930s to the 1950s, with some surviving much longer on small farms.<br />
	The pattern was built by numerous manufacturers, such as Blumhardt, Kaessbohrer, Kögel, and many others. They were also widely exported throughout Europe.
</p>

<p>
	It's pretty perfect for all the vintage tractors that have emerged lately, but also wouldn't look wrong behind an Italeri Opel Blitz.
